WebBohr velocity There is a widespread opinion that stopping of projectiles at velocities below the Bohr velocity is essentially quantal. The claim appears plausible for insulators to the extent that electron promotion may be an essential sink of energy. WebThe electron’s speed is largest in the first Bohr orbit, for n = 1, which is the orbit closest to the nucleus. The radius of the first Bohr orbit is called the Bohr radius of hydrogen, denoted as a0.
